In recent years, rental prices in Ireland have seen sharp increases, particularly in urban centers such as Dublin, Cork, and Galway. According to data available on Nozy.ie, the average rent in Dublin has escalated by approximately 6% over the past year, reflecting the sentiments of a stretched market. These trends are mirrored in other major cities, where the supply struggles to keep up with a growing population and an influx of international professionals.
One of the main drivers of rental market inflation is the imbalance between supply and demand. With a limited number of new homes being constructed, the existing housing stock is insufficient to meet the needs of renters. Economic factors such as rising wages and low unemployment rates contribute to the increasing rental costs, as they enhance consumers' ability to pay more for housing. Simultaneously, inflation affects construction costs and consequently the rate at which new properties are developed. Policy decisions at the national and local levels also have significant impacts on rental market inflation. Initiatives aimed at increasing housing supply, such as relaxed planning regulations, can alter market dynamics.
